About Sohodolls

Sohodolls emerged at a time when the lines between alternative rock and synth-pop began to blur, carving out a space that resonated with a generation navigating urban life’s complexities.

Their music encapsulates the vibrant chaos of city living, drawing on themes of nightlife, desire, and self-exploration, which positioned them as a voice for those seeking both escapism and authenticity in their artistic expression. The band’s approach combines punchy rhythms with sleek electronic elements, creating an atmosphere that invites listeners into a world that feels simultaneously familiar and provocative. This innovative layering of sounds allows their tracks to pulse with energy while maintaining an air of intimacy, encouraging audiences to reflect on their own experiences within the context of the songs. Common lyrical themes revolve around themes of love, longing, and the highs and lows of urban life, often presented through a lens that balances sincerity with a touch of irony. The storytelling is vivid yet impressionistic, allowing listeners to immerse themselves in the emotional landscapes they create without overly dictating specific narratives.
